中文字幕av专区_日韩电影在线播放_精品国产精品久久一区免费式_av在线免费观看网站

溫馨提示×

溫馨提示×

您好,登錄后才能下訂單哦!

密碼登錄×
登錄注冊×
其他方式登錄
點擊 登錄注冊 即表示同意《億速云用戶服務條款》

db2建庫的流程是怎么樣的

發布時間:2021-12-30 11:05:07 來源:億速云 閱讀:185 作者:柒染 欄目:云計算

db2建庫的流程是怎么樣的,很多新手對此不是很清楚,為了幫助大家解決這個難題,下面小編將為大家詳細講解,有這方面需求的人可以來學習下,希望你能有所收獲。

開始建庫

1.建用戶組 AIX

mkgroup db2iadm1  (放實例的組) mkgroup db2fadm1

mkgroup dasadm1 (dasadm在有要求的情況下需要建組,一般不建)

LINUX

/usr/sbin/groupadd db2iadm1   /usr/sbin/groupadd db2fadm1  

/usr/sbin/groupadd dasadm1    (沒有要求,一般不建)  

2.建用戶并設置密碼 AIX

mkuser  groups=db2iadm1  home=/home/snuaasit  db2inst1             (實例用戶)                  

mkuser  groups=db2fadm1  home=/home/db2fenc1  db2fenc1           (受防護用戶)               mkuser  groups=dasadm1  home=/home/dasusr1  dasusr1                (das用戶一般不建)              

mkuser  groups=staff  home=/home/db2admin   db2admin                 (數據源用戶)                  

/usr/sbin/groupdel db2adm1  (刪除組)      

passwd db2inst1 passwd db2fenc1

passwd dasusr1        (修改密碼命令:passwd 用戶名 (提示改密碼))

passwd db2admin     (需要su - 任意用戶,然后su - 回需要改密碼的用戶,進行確認,才不會提示密碼錯誤)  

LINUX

/usr/sbin/useradd -m -g db2iadm1 -d /home/db2inst1 db2inst1                 /usr/sbin/useradd -m -g db2fadm1 -d /home/db2fenc1 db2fenc1               /usr/sbin/useradd -m -g staff -d /home/db2admin db2admin      

/usr/sbin/userdel -m -g staff -d /home/db2admin db2admin  (刪除用戶) rm -rf  db2inst    (用戶名)            

passwd db2inst1

passwd db2fenc1      (修改密碼命令:passwd 用戶名 (提示改密碼))

passwd db2admin     (需要su - 任意用戶,然后su - 回需要改密碼的用戶,進行確認,才不會提示密碼錯誤)  

3.建實例并修改必要參數 AIX

cd  /opt/IBM/db2/V9.7/instance      (進入/opt/ibm/db2/V9.7/instance目錄執行命令) ./db2icrt -a server -u db2fenc1 db2inst1

./dascrt -u dasusr1  

LINUX

cd  /opt/ibm/db2/V9.7/instance    

./db2icrt -a server -u db2fenc1 db2inst1

./dascrt -u dasusr1

AIX和LINUX  (MUST)

su - db2inst1

db2set DB2COMM=TCPIP                    (修改TCP/IP變量) db2 get dbm cfg | grep -i svcename     (修改實例參數端口號)

cat /etc/services                                   (查看該實例自動分配的端口號,并用下面一句語句修改)

db2 update dbm cfg using svcename xxxxxx  

4. 建庫 建模式 改參數

chown db2admin:staff  /db2data      (如果建庫語句有錯誤執行此語句,添加實例訪問權限 ps:需要在root用戶下執行,否則可能無權限) chown db2inst1:db2iadm1 /db2data/

chown db2inst1:db2iadm1 /db2data/db2log chown db2inst1:db2iadm1 /db2data/db2arch  

db2 "create database dbname AUTOMATIC STORAGE YES ON /db2data (數據文件目錄,一般放在掛載的容量較大的目錄下)  DBPATH ON /db2data(數據庫目錄) USING CODESET UTF-8 TERRITORY CN COLLATE USING SYSTEM"

db2 create schema db2inst1 authorization yunwei   (創建了db2inst1模式,并授權給yunwei)  

db2 update db cfg for dbname using LOCKTIMEOUT 15   (修改鎖時,一般15)

db2 update db cfg for suning using NEWLOGPATH /db2data/db2log  (修改日志路徑,如有要求就設置,如沒有要求就默認)

db2 update db cfg for UIMGDB using logarchmeth2 disk:/db2data/db2arch  (修改歸檔日志,生產庫最好改下路徑,別OFF)

db2 backup db SAMDB to /dev/null  (初始備份,執行上面一句必須連帶執行下面一句,不然會報錯SQL1116N)

db2 update dbm cfg using INSTANCE_MEMORY 9751750    (物理內存的百分之八十)

db2 update db cfg for SAMDB using DATABASE_MEMORY 6826220  (實例內存的百分之七十)  

db2 "SELECT * FROM SYSCAT.BUFFERPOOLS"

db2 "alter bufferpool IBMDEFAULTBP size 3413100"  (數據庫大小的百分之五十)  

db2 grant dbadm on database to user db2admin     (數據源用戶賦權限)  

(下面是一個給運維用戶賦查詢權限的小方法) vi test.ddl    (建一個.ddl文件存放下面的語句)

select 'grant select on table '||rtrim(tabschema)||'."'||tabname||'" to user yunwei;' from syscat.tables;   (建查詢和賦權語句合并,建所有的表的查詢權限賦給yunwei用戶)

db2 -txf test.ddl > test.sql    

db2 -tvf test.sql > test.out

看完上述內容是否對您有幫助呢?如果還想對相關知識有進一步的了解或閱讀更多相關文章,請關注億速云行業資訊頻道,感謝您對億速云的支持。

向AI問一下細節

免責聲明:本站發布的內容(圖片、視頻和文字)以原創、轉載和分享為主,文章觀點不代表本網站立場,如果涉及侵權請聯系站長郵箱:is@yisu.com進行舉報,并提供相關證據,一經查實,將立刻刪除涉嫌侵權內容。

db2
AI

楚雄市| 高碑店市| 丁青县| 多伦县| 永善县| 长葛市| 庆安县| 措美县| 五台县| 嫩江县| 淄博市| 邯郸市| 沾化县| 长武县| 岳普湖县| 安溪县| 贞丰县| 景泰县| 依兰县| 建始县| 平顶山市| 鄯善县| 叙永县| 宜州市| 十堰市| 芜湖县| 乌拉特前旗| 寿阳县| 沾益县| 会昌县| 海晏县| 禹城市| 时尚| 乐业县| 山西省| 壤塘县| 当涂县| 沙田区| 平远县| 西乌珠穆沁旗| 旬邑县|